South Aust to set energy storage target
AAP
The South Australian Labor government has promised to establish Australia's first renewable energy storage target if returned at the March election.
The 25 per cent target by 2025 will drive the installation of 750 megawatts of battery storage, Premier Jay Weatherill said.
"More renewable energy means cheaper power for South Australians and energy storage is the key to delivering that low-cost electricity around the clock," Mr Weatherill said.
